The issue of discrimination and representativeness in the police has long been an important one. As we approach the ten-year anniversary of The Stephen Lawrence Enquiry, Demos and the National Association of Muslim Police have written a report, "Diversity in Modern Policing" which sets out the position of BME and Muslim officers in the police force.

Between April and July 2008 we surveyed all the constabularies in the UK and half responded. Based on these returns, we estimate that around 5% of officers are from BME background. Muslims officers make up less than 1% of the total. Our figures also suggest that the police are potentially not making use of some of its best human resources, in particular in countering terrorism, as well as other forms of community police work and engagement.
